Beat Hot Flashes and Night Sweats Naturally
Are you struggling with the intense symptoms of menopause like hot flashes and night sweats? These episodes can disrupt your sleep, affect your daily life, and leave you feeling exhausted. But don't fret! There are many natural ways to find comfort and regain control over your health.
By implementing some simple lifestyle adjustments, you can alleviate the frequency of these problems. Here are a few tips:
- Stay cool by dressing in layers, using fans, and avoiding spicy foods and caffeine.
- Try out stress-reducing techniques like yoga, meditation, or deep breathing exercises.
- Incorporate a healthy di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ains.
- Look into herbal remedies like black cohosh or oil of evening primrose.
Remember to speak with your doctor to determine the most suitable course of treatment for you. With a little effort and dedication, you can effectively manage hot flashes and night sweats naturally.

Overcome the Heat: Herbal Remedies for Menopause Symptoms
Menopause can be a difficult time for women, bringing a host of uncomfortable side effects. One of the most common issues is sudden temperature changes, which can leave you feeling flushed and drained. Fortunately, there are many powerful natural remedies to help you alleviate these symptoms and feel your best.
A few simple tweaks to your daily routine can make a big difference.
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day. This helps regulate body temperature and reduce the severity of hot flashes.
Choose loose-fitting, breathable clothing made from natural materials like cotton or linen. Avoid tight clothing that can trap heat.
